Let's say you're given two plants. When you receive Plant A, it is 4 cm tall, and it grows at a constant rate of 2 cm per month. When you receive Plant B, it is 8 cm tall, and it grows at a constant rate of 1 cm per month. Will the two plants ever be the same height? If so, when will that happen?

To determine if the two plants will ever be the same height, we can set up equations for their heights over time.

Let's denote the number of months after receiving the plants as \( t \).

  • The height of Plant A after \( t \) months: \[ \text{Height of Plant A} = 4 + 2t \]

  • The height of Plant B after \( t \) months: \[ \text{Height of Plant B} = 8 + 1t \]

To find out when the two plants will be the same height, we set the two equations equal to each other: \[ 4 + 2t = 8 + 1t \]

Now, we solve for \( t \):

  1. Subtract \( 1t \) from both sides: \[ 4 + 2t - 1t = 8 \] This simplifies to: \[ 4 + 1t = 8 \]

  2. Subtract 4 from both sides: \[ 1t = 8 - 4 \] Simplifying gives: \[ 1t = 4 \]

  3. Thus, \( t = 4 \).

Now, we can check their heights at \( t = 4 \):

  • Height of Plant A: \[ \text{Height of Plant A} = 4 + 2(4) = 4 + 8 = 12 \text{ cm} \]

  • Height of Plant B: \[ \text{Height of Plant B} = 8 + 1(4) = 8 + 4 = 12 \text{ cm} \]

Both plants will be the same height of 12 cm after 4 months.
